Statement of Purpose

The COVID-19 pandemic caused disruption to many communities, companies and countries. It rendered organizational systems defunct. The severity of disruption meant that only the most resilient businesses could survive and a very few thrived. Family businesses were no exception to this rule.

Family businesses have traditionally focused on the long-term with medium risk-aversion. The new reality has resulted in families assessing their purpose and values. This reality, coupled with the role they play in the community has necessitated a refocus on structures, governance and leadership.

Families are now rethinking how they shape their future. Our focus for the maiden edition was to interrogate how family businesses are able to build personal and organisational resilience in their organisations.
